summ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2022-11-03gnu: java-commons-compress: Update to 1.21.Julien Lepiller
* gnu/packages/java.scm (java-commons-compress): Update to 1.21. (java-osgi-annotation, java-osgi-core): Create pom file and install from it. * gnu/packages/maven.scm (java-surefire-parent-pom): Fix pom fixing.
2022-11-03gnu: Add java-asm-3.Julien Lepiller
* gnu/packages/java.scm (java-asm): New variable.
2022-11-03gnu: Add java-ow-util-ant-tasks.Julien Lepiller
* gnu/packages/java.scm (java-ow-util-ant-tasks): New variable.
2022-11-03gnu: Add java-zstd.Julien Lepiller
* gnu/packages/java.scm (java-zstd): New variable.
2022-11-03gnu: Add java-brotli.Julien Lepiller
* gnu/packages/compression.scm (java-brotli): New variable.
2022-11-03gnu: Add cl-hu.dwim.graphviz.Sharlatan Hellseher
* gnu/packages/lisp-xyz.scm (ecl-hu.dwim.graphviz, cl-hu.dwim.graphviz, sbcl-hu.dwim.graphviz): New variables. Signed-off-by: Guillaume Le Vaillant <glv@posteo.net>
2022-11-03gnu: dedukti: Update to 2.7.Julien Lepiller
* gnu/packages/ocaml.scm (dedukti): Update to 2.7.
2022-11-03gnu: Remove emacs-dedukti-mode.Julien Lepiller
* gnu/packages/ocaml.scm (emacs-dedukti-mode): Delete variable.
2022-11-03gnu: Remove emacs-flycheck-dedukti.Julien Lepiller
* gnu/packages/ocaml.scm (emacs-flycheck-dedukti): Delete variable.
2022-11-03gnu: ocaml-ssl: Update to 0.5.13.Julien Lepiller
* gnu/packages/ocaml.scm (ocaml-ssl): Update to 0.5.13.
2022-11-03gnu: ocaml-ocp-index: Update to 1.3.4.Julien Lepiller
* gnu/packages/ocaml.scm (ocaml-ocp-index): Update to 1.3.4.
2022-11-03gnu: ocaml-digestif: Update to 1.1.3.Julien Lepiller
* gnu/packages/ocaml.scm (ocaml-digestif): Update to 1.1.3.
2022-11-03gnu: ocaml-fileutils: Update to 0.6.4.Julien Lepiller
* gnu/packages/ocaml.scm (ocaml-fileutils): Update to 0.6.4.
2022-11-03gnu: dune-bootstrap: Update to 3.5.0.Julien Lepiller
* gnu/packages/ocaml.scm (dune-bootstrap): Update to 3.5.0.
2022-11-03gnu: sbcl: Remove obsolete fix-shared-library-makefile phase.Pierre Neidhardt
* gnu/packages/lisp.scm (sbcl)[arguments]: Remove phase since "cc" has been replace by "CC" upstream.
2022-11-02gnu: coreutils: Disable the test-tls tests on the hurd.Christopher Baines
These tests seem to lead to both consistent and inconsistent failures, so marking them as XFAIL as is done with some other tests doesn't help. So this commit means that they're skipped. * gnu/packages/base.scm (coreutils)[arguments]: Disable the test-tls tests on the hurd.
2022-11-02gnu: openconnect-sso: Update to 0.8.0.Efraim Flashner
* gnu/packages/vpn.scm (openconnect-sso): Update to 0.8.0. [source]: Download using git-fetch. [build-system]: Switch to pyproject-build-system. [arguments]: Don't skip tests. Remove custom 'check phase. Move custom 'wrap-qt-process-path phase to after 'check. [inputs]: Add poetry. [native-inputs]: Remove python-setuptools-scm. Add python-pytest-asyncio, python-pytest-httpserver.
2022-11-02gnu: isc-dhcp: Add grep input.Guillaume Le Vaillant
The grep program is required by the dhclient script. * gnu/packages/admin.scm (isc-dhcp)[inputs]: Add grep. [arguments]: Add grep to wrapping in 'post-install' phase.
2022-11-02gnu: dovecot: Use standard mkdir-p/perms.Julien Lepiller
* gnu/services/mail.scm (%dovecot-activation): Use (gnu build utils).
2022-11-02installer: Skip the backtrace page on user abort.Mathieu Othacehe
When the user aborts the installation because a core dump is discovered or the installation command failed, displaying the abort backtrace doesn't make much sense. Hide it when the abort condition is &user-abort-error and skip directly to the dump page. * gnu/installer/steps.scm (&user-abort-error): New variable. (user-abort-error?): New procedure. * gnu/installer/newt/final.scm (run-install-failed-page): Raise a user-abort-error. * gnu/installer/newt/welcome.scm (run-welcome-page): Ditto. * gnu/installer.scm (installer-program): Hide the backtrace page and directly propose to dump the report when the a &user-abort-error is raised.
2022-11-02installer: Add core dump support.Mathieu Othacehe
Fixes: <https://issues.guix.gnu.org/58733> * gnu/installer.scm (installer-program): Enable core dump generation. * gnu/installer/dump.scm (%core-dump): New variable. (prepare-dump): Copy the core dump file. * gnu/installer/newt/welcome.scm (run-welcome-page): Propose to report an installation that previously generated a core dump.
2022-11-02gnu: randomjungle: Use older gfortran.Ricardo Wurmus
* gnu/packages/machine-learning.scm (randomjungle)[native-inputs]: Use gfortran-7.
2022-11-02gnu: randomjungle: Fix unpack by providing a conventional file name.Ricardo Wurmus
* gnu/packages/machine-learning.scm (randomjungle)[source]: Override file name to avoid an unpack error.
2022-11-02gnu: Add cgns.Ricardo Wurmus
* gnu/packages/engineering.scm (cgns): New variable. Co-authored-by: Ontje Luensdorf <Ontje.Luensdorf@dlr.de>
2022-11-02gnu: emacs-evil-traces: Update to 0.2.0.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-evil-traces): Update to 0.2.0. [arguments]: Use G-expressions. Remove trailing #T. [synopsis, description]: Rationalize emphasis and capitalization.
2022-11-01gnu: Shorten package synopsis.Vagrant Cascadian
* gnu/packages/crates-io.scm (rust-inflections-1): Shorten synopsis. (rust-clap-conf-0.1): Likewise. * gnu/packages/gtk.scm (volctl): Likewise. * gnu/packages/haskell-xyz.scm (ghc-unliftio): Likewise. * gnu/packages/kde-pim.scm (korganizer): Likewise. * gnu/packages/kde.scm (kuserfeedback): Likewise. * gnu/packages/pascal.scm (p2c): Likewise. * gnu/packages/python-xyz.scm (python-ttystatus): Likewise. * gnu/packages/qt.scm (qtwebplugin): Likewise.
2022-11-02gnu: linux-libre: Add linux-libre 6.0.6.Leo Famulari
* gnu/packages/linux.scm (linux-libre-6.0-version, linux-libre-6.0-pristine-source, linux-libre-6.0-source, linux-libre-headers-6.0, linux-libre-6.0): New variables. * gnu/packages/aux-files/linux-libre/6.0-arm.conf, gnu/packages/aux-files/linux-libre/6.0-arm64.conf, gnu/packages/aux-files/linux-libre/6.0-i686.conf, gnu/packages/aux-files/linux-libre/6.0-x86_64.conf: New files. * Makefile.am (AUX_FILES): Add them.
2022-11-01gnu: Add python-autoflake8.Maxim Cournoyer
* gnu/packages/python-xyz.scm (python-autoflake8): New variable.
2022-11-01gnu: emacs-compat: Update to 28.1.2.2.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-compat): Update to 28.1.2.2.
2022-11-01gnu: emacs-dockerfile-mode: Update to 1.8.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-dockerfile-mode): Update to 1.8.
2022-11-01gnu: emacs-skempo: Update to 0.2.2.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-skempo): Update to 0.2.2.
2022-11-01gnu: emacs-mct: Update to 0.5.1.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-mct): Update to 0.5.1.
2022-11-01gnu: emacs-consult-lsp: Update to 1.1.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-consult-lsp): Update to 1.1. [synopsis]: Use proper capitalization.
2022-11-01gnu: fet: Update to 6.7.0.Nicolas Goaziou
* gnu/packages/education.scm (fet): Update to 6.7.0.
2022-11-01gnu: giac: Update to 1.9.0-27.Nicolas Goaziou
* gnu/packages/algebra.scm (giac): Update to 1.9.0-27.
2022-11-01gnu: Add python-zope-sqlalchemy.Maxim Cournoyer
* gnu/packages/python-web.scm (python-zope-sqlalchemy): New variable.
2022-11-01gnu: ncdu-2: Update to 2.2.1.Efraim Flashner
* gnu/packages/ncdu.scm (ncdu-2): Update to 2.2.1.
2022-10-30gnu: openssl: Update to 1.1.1s.Tobias Geerinckx-Rice
* gnu/packages/tls.scm (openssl): Update to 1.1.1s.
2022-11-01gnu: python-keyring: Update to 23.9.3.Maxim Cournoyer
* gnu/packages/python-crypto.scm (python-keyring): Update to 23.9.3. [origin]: Fix indentation. [build-system]: Use pyproject-build-system. [test-flags]: New argument. [phases]: Remove check phase. Add workaround-test-failure phase. [native-inputs]: Remove python-setuptools. [propagated-inputs]: Add python-importlib-metadata and python-jaraco-classes.
2022-10-30gnu: openssl: Update to 3.0.7 [fixes CVE-2022-3786, CVE-2022-3602].Tobias Geerinckx-Rice
* gnu/packages/tls.scm (openssl): Update to 3.0.7.
2022-11-01doc: contributing: Use proper subsections.(
* doc/contributing.texi ("Submitting Patches") ["Sending a Patch Series", "Teams"]: Convert to numbered subsections. Add nodes. Signed-off-by: Liliana Marie Prikler <liliana.prikler@gmail.com>
2022-11-01gnu: emacs-consult-notmuch: Update to 0.8.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-consult-notmuch): Update to 0.8. [description]: Use proper capitalization.
2022-11-01gnu: Merge EMACS-JANPATH-EVIL-NUMBERS and EMACS-EVIL-NUMBERS.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-evil-numbers): Use EMACS-JANPATH-EVIL-NUMBERS definition. (emacs-janpath-evil-numbers): Deprecate package. Both packages are fork of the same project, the latter being unmaintained.
2022-11-01gnu: emacs-janpath-evil-numbers: Activate tests.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-janpath-evil-numbers)[arguments]: Activate tests. [native-inputs]: Add EMACS-ERT-RUNNER.
2022-11-01gnu: emacs-janpath-evil-numbers: Update to 0.7.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-janpath-evil-numbers): Update to 0.6. [source]<origin>: Update upstream URL. [home-page]: Update URL.
2022-11-01gnu: emacs-alarm-clock: Update to 1.0.3.jgart
* gnu/packages/emacs-xyz.scm (emacs-alarm-clock): Update to 1.0.3. Signed-off-by: Nicolas Goaziou <mail@nicolasgoaziou.fr>
2022-10-31gnu: Fix various lint issues in synopsis and descriptions.Vagrant Cascadian
* gnu/packages/android.scm (etc1tool)[synopsis]: Drop trailing period. * gnu/packages/bioinformatics.scm (mudskipper)[synopsis]: Likewise. * gnu/packages/crates-io.scm (rust-async-log-attributes-1)[synopsis]: Likewise. (rust-atomic-polyfill-1)[synopsis]: Likewise. (rust-modifier-0.1)[synopsis]: Likewise. (rust-openssl-macros-0.1)[synopsis]: Likewise. (rust-syn-mid-0.5)[synopsis]: Likewise. (rust-toml-edit-0.14)[synopsis]: Likewise. (rust-valuable-derive-0.1)[synopsis]: Likewise. (rust-inflections-1)[synopsis]: Likewise. * gnu/packages/databases.scm (python-databases)[synopsis]: Likewise. * gnu/packages/games.scm (liquidwar6)[synopsis]: Likewise. * gnu/packages/golang.scm (go-golang.org-x-sync-errgroup)[synopsis]: Likewise. * gnu/packages/guile-xyz.scm (guile-config)[synopsis]: Likewise. * gnu/packages/haskell-web.scm (ghc-hxt-xpath)[synopsis]: Likewise. * gnu/packages/haskell-xyz.scm (ghc-string-qq)[synopsis]: Likewise. * gnu/packages/machine-learning.scm (python-lap)[synopsis]: Likewise. (python-pyro-api)[synopsis]: Likewise. * gnu/packages/messaging.scm (python-librecaptcha)[synopsis]: Likewise. * gnu/packages/python-check.scm (python-pytest-cram)[synopsis]: Likewise. * gnu/packages/python-web.scm (python-jschema-to-python)[synopsis]: Likewise. (python-sarif-om)[synopsis]: Likewise. (python-socksio)[synopsis]: Likewise. (python-msrest)[synopsis]: Likewise. * gnu/packages/tor.scm (torsocks)[synopsis]: Likewise. * gnu/packages/cran.scm (r-rlist)[synopsis]: Remove leading article. * gnu/packages/crates-io.scm (rust-clippy-lints-0.0.153)[synopsis]: Likewise. (rust-simplelog-0.11)[synopsis]: Likewise. * gnu/packages/samba.scm (wsdd)[synopsis]: Likewise. * gnu/packages/crates-io.scm (rust-spki-0.4)[synopsis]: Remove trailing whitespace. * gnu/packages/golang.scm (go-github-com-mattn-go-zglob)[description]: Remove leading whitespace. * gnu/packages/haskell-check.scm (ghc-crypto-cipher-tests)[description]: Likewise. * gnu/packages/lisp-xyz.scm (sbcl-ctype)[synopsis]: Remove trailing whitespace. * gnu/packages/mpi.scm (openmpi-thread-multiple)[description]: Remove leading whitespace. * gnu/packages/node-xyz.scm (node-string-decoder)[synopsis]: Remove trailing whitespace.
2022-11-01gnu: emacs-lice-el: Improve package style.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-lice-el)[arguments]: Use G-expressions. <#:include>: Add "template" directory instead of installing files manually. <#:phases>: Use ELPA-DIRECTORY. Remove trailing #T.
2022-11-01gnu: emacs-lice-el: Update to 0.3.Nicolas Goaziou
* gnu/packages/emacs-xyz.scm (emacs-lice-el): Update to 0.3.
2022-10-30gnu: ntfs-3g: Update to 2022.10.3 [security fixes].Tobias Geerinckx-Rice
* gnu/packages/linux.scm (ntfs-3g): Update to 2022.10.3. [source]: Don't explicitly return #t from snippet. [arguments]: Don't explicitly return #t from phases.